Another value of our Congress in Romecomes from our encounter with Saint Peter. In the Pueri Cantores tradition the Congresses organised in Romeare particularly important from this point of view. This comes directly from the spiritual experience of Mgr. Maillet, himself. Surrounded by the evil and injustice of the war, which at that time seemed to dominate the world, he turned with faith to Christ. So as to strengthen this faith, he decided to ask help from St. Peter, to whom Christ himself had given this task: “…establish yourbrothers.” (Lk. 22:32). In fact, Christians over the centuries, in order to reinforce their faith, have always come to Rometo pray on the tomb of St. Peter and to listen to the teachings of his successor, the Pope. Thus following the indications of Mgr. Maillet and that ancient tradition we, too, come to Rometo seek new light to illuminate our own faith. In this way we, too, will have occasion to pray on the tomb of St. Peter and to listen to his successor, Pope Benedict XVI. During our roman Congress we will not lack a meeting with the Pope. The 2010-2011 Congress of Romewill also offer us another pearl of great value. We will have the occasion to renew our link with the Patron Saint of the Pueri Cantores, Saint Domenico Savio. Right from the beginning of the Pueri Cantores, that young saint accompanied our young singers. This time we wish to make Saint Domenico Savio’s presence in our Federation to become even stronger: by means of his relics. These relics, a small part of his bones, have been offered to us through the generosity of the Salesian Fathers. The official presentation will take place during the opening ceremony of our Congress presided over by Cardinal Tarcisio Bertone, the Secretary of State of the Holy See, who is also a Salesian.
